Вопросы от начинающих MQL5 MT5 MetaTrader 5 - страница 1350
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
... в развитие предыдущего вопроса
Возможен ли какой то буфер обмена между Экспертом и индикаторами открытыми на одном графике?
Т.е. эксперт что то туда кладет, а индикаторы что то от туда читают.
База данных
Столкнулся с непотной проблемой. Во время работы советника иногда советник завершается из-за деления на ноль.
А вот 1321 строка.
Как такое возможно ? Ведь в первом условии " B " не рано нулю. Значит и во втором случае не может быть деления ноль. Или условия проверяются не по порядку ?
Столкнулся с непотной проблемой.
Вы правильно говорите, условия проверяются по порядку. Если первое ложь, то второе не проверяется.
Однако, у Вас терминал ругается на 60-й символ в строке, а деление находится от силы на 17 месте. Возможно, Вы смотрите на код не в 'C.mqh'.
Ещё люблю делать так:
Однако, у Вас терминал ругается на 60-й символ в строке, а деление находится от силы на 17 месте.
Я изменил строку для удобства чтения. Вот оригинал.
Знак деления находиться именно в 60 позиции.
Сделайте принт "В" перед условием. Что напишет?
Попробую. Но к сожалению искрит только на реале. И очень редко. Нужно ждать...
Делаю как у Алексея, 2 ифа. В одном ифе с логическим И тоже ловил деление на ноль в следующих И. 2 ифа решили проблему.
И тоже ловил деление на ноль в следующих И. 2 ифа решили проблему.
Спасибо.